Navigating the Job Market in a Competitive Landscape

Finding a perfect job can be a tough road in today's saturated market. With so many applicants competing for the same positions it is crucial to stand out fromthe competition. To increase your chances, develop a strong resume and cover letter that highlights your unique skills and experience.. Network with industry professionals and attend career fairs to build valuable connections. Continuously learn new skills and stay up-to-date on industry trends to remain competitive. Be patient, persistent, and don't be afraid to put yourself out there.

Ace Your Next Job Interview

Landing your dream job starts with crushing your next interview. First, explore the company and role thoroughly to demonstrate genuine interest. Craft compelling answers to common interview questions, showcasing your skills and experiences relevant to the position. Practice your responses aloud to build confidence and fluency. During the interview, attend attentively, ask insightful questions, and highlight your enthusiasm for the opportunity. Finally, send a personalized thank-you note after the interview to reiterate your interest and leave a lasting impression.
